What is a College Wrestling Dual?

A college wrestling dual is a competitive match between two teams, each consisting of wrestlers from different weight classes. The teams face off in a series of matches, with each wrestler competing against an opponent from the opposing team in their respective weight class. The goal is to accumulate points for their team by winning matches and scoring points through takedowns, escapes, and pins. The team with the highest number of points at the end of the dual is declared the winner.

Exploring the Duration of College Wrestling Duals

Now let's dive deeper into the duration of college wrestling duals. As mentioned earlier, the length of a dual can vary depending on several factors. One of the main factors is the number of weight classes. In college wrestling, there are typically 10 weight classes, ranging from the lightest weight class (125 pounds) to the heaviest weight class (285 pounds).

Each weight class consists of a match between two wrestlers, with the goal of scoring points and winning the match. The duration of each match can vary, but it is typically around six minutes. However, if there is a tie at the end of the match, it can go into overtime, further extending the duration of the dual.

In addition to the number of weight classes, the competitiveness of the teams also plays a role in determining the length of a wrestling dual. If both teams are evenly matched and the matches are closely contested, the dual can last longer as each match becomes a battle for points and victory.

Q: Can a wrestling dual end in a tie?

A: Yes, a wrestling dual can end in a tie if both teams have an equal number of points at the end of the dual. In such cases, tie-breaking criteria, such as the number of individual match victories or bonus points, may be used to determine the winner.
